I applied online. The process took 3 months. I interviewed at JLR (Royal Leamington Spa, England)
Interview
Applied online, competency questions and motivation.
Had to do 2 online tests (numerical and logical reasoning).
Went to assessment centre, had to do competency based interview, role play, group exercise and tests.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
What are the future challenges for the automotive industry?
I applied through college or university. I interviewed at JLR (Chennai) in Oct 2025
Interview
The selection process consisted of an initial test that evaluated both fundamental concepts and core technical knowledge. Candidates who qualified were then invited for a single interview round, and the final selection was made based on their overall performance in the interview.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Questions were based on the resume and some fundamentals, like what is the purpose of a flywheel in an engine?
I applied through college or university.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at JLR (Guwahati) in Aug 2024
Interview
Applied for the EVSW profile as part of on-campus intern drive. Initial screening done through an OA which had electrical/electronics based mcqs.
Next the shortlisted candidates had an online interview.
There were 2 interviewers since the role is EV-SW so one interviewer for the electrical part and one for the software.
In the 1 hr interview, I was asked a few questions related to my cv, then the electrical-core guy asked me a few questions about digital electronics and control systems and the software guy asked a simple question on Binary search. Then the core guy asked me about one of my projects and that was it, both interviewers seemed satisfied.
